Capella

Capella Nanjing

David Chipperfield-designed, with heritage suites and villas; Capella's third hotel in mainland China.

Nanjing, China

First look

Capella's run through mainland China continues in Nanjing, with an opening reported for 2027. The design is by David Chipperfield, and the room mix is reported to combine heritage suites with standalone villas. A general manager has already been appointed, which usually signals a project moving past the paper stage.

This would be Capella's third hotel in mainland China, after Shanghai and the Hainan resort, so the brand clearly sees room to keep growing there rather than treating any one city as the anchor. Chipperfield is a serious name to attach to a heritage-led property, and the suites-plus-villas format suggests Capella wants this to read as more than a city business hotel. What we will be watching for is how the historic fabric of Nanjing shapes the building, and whether the villa component lands as genuinely residential or just a premium room category.
